Khem Raj
627198a98f audit: Inherit python3targetconfig
It uses python3-config during build to grok the python specific
includedirs, therefore its important to ensure that target specific
python3-config is used, otherwise currently it defaults to native
python3-config which ends up adding native python3 include paths
which might work out ok but is exposed when target is 32bit + lfs
enabled, the headers don't match between native and target python

Peter Kjellerstedt
c354f92778 chrony: Remove the libcap and nss PACKAGECONFIGs
There is no need for these configs on their own and they would only mess
up the sechash and privdrop configs. To actually enable sechash one also
had to enable nss, and to enable privdrop one also had to enable libcap.

This also avoids passing --with-libcap if privdrop is enabled since the
option does not exist.

Peter Kjellerstedt
aa811aa776 chrony: Make it possible to enable editline support again
Support for readline was dropped in Chrony 4.2. However, the
--disable-readline option still remains (it is used to completely ignore
all forms of command line editing, even though the only remaining
variant is editline). So keeping the readline PACKAGECONFIG and making
it pass --disable-readline when it is not enabled disabled support for
editline, and if it was enabled it instead passed --without-editline,
which also disabled support for editline. Thus there was no way to
enable editline support.
